The CY7C408A-25VI is a high-speed, low-power asynchronous FIFO (First-In, First-Out) memory device manufactured by Cypress Semiconductor. It is designed for buffering data between systems operating at different clock rates or for temporary storage in data processing applications.
Applications
- Data Acquisition Systems: Used to buffer data between high-speed ADCs/DACs and slower processing units.
- Networking Equipment: Employed in routers, switches, and network interface cards (NICs) for packet buffering.
- Video Processing: Used in video encoders, decoders, and frame buffers.
- Industrial Automation: Integrated into programmable logic controllers (PLCs) and other industrial control systems.
- Telecommunications: Used in base stations and communication equipment for data buffering and rate adaptation.
Features
- Memory Depth: 4,096 x 8 bits (4K x 8)
- Access Time: 25 ns
- Asynchronous Operation: Allows independent read and write clocks.
- Low Power Consumption: Designed for energy-efficient operation.
- Flag Signals: Provides flags for Empty, Full, Half-Full, and Programmable Almost-Empty/Almost-Full.
- Data Width: 8 bits
- Package Type: SOIC (Small Outline Integrated Circuit)
- Operating Voltage: 5V
- Operating Temperature Range: -40°C to +85°C
Benefits
- High-Speed Data Transfer: The 25ns access time enables fast data transfer rates.
- Asynchronous Operation: Simplifies system design by allowing independent clock domains.
- Low Power Consumption: Reduces overall system power consumption and heat dissipation.
- Flexible Flag Signals: Allows for precise control of data flow and prevents overflow or underflow conditions.
- Easy Integration: The SOIC package simplifies board layout and assembly.
- Wide Operating Temperature Range: Suitable for use in a variety of environmental conditions.
- Large Memory Capacity: The 4K x 8 memory depth provides ample buffering space for data.
Additional Details
The CY7C408A-25VI FIFO memory utilizes advanced CMOS technology to achieve high speed and low power consumption. The asynchronous architecture allows for independent control of read and write operations, making it ideal for applications where data rates may vary. The flag signals provide critical information about the status of the FIFO, enabling efficient data management and preventing errors.
The SOIC package is a standard surface mount package that is easy to handle and solder. The device is typically used in conjunction with microprocessors, microcontrollers, and other digital logic devices to implement data buffering and synchronization functions.